How to Use
To properly install and operate the DC 24V P50/30 65KG Lifting Solenoid Electromagnet, first ensure the electromagnet is securely mounted to your lifting equipment or automation system using appropriate mechanical fasteners. The mounting surface should be clean and free of debris to ensure optimal magnetic contact with ferrous materials. Connect the electromagnet terminals to a reliable 24V DC power supply, ensuring proper polarity: positive to the positive terminal and negative to the ground or negative terminal. For automated control, integrate the electromagnet into your PLC or control system using a relay or solid-state switch that can handle the electromagnet's power requirements.
Before lifting any load, verify that the ferrous material to be lifted is clean and free of oil, paint, or non-ferrous coatings that could reduce magnetic holding force. Apply 24V DC power to energize the electromagnet and allow 1-2 seconds for the magnetic field to fully develop before attempting to lift. Always operate within the 65KG maximum lifting capacity and never exceed this limit, as overloading can damage the electromagnet and create safety hazards. For automated systems, implement safety interlocks to ensure the electromagnet is fully energized before lifting begins and remains energized during material transport. After completing your lifting operation, de-energize the electromagnet to release the load. Regular inspection of the electromagnet coil and mounting hardware ensures continued safe operation and extends product lifespan.

Can this electromagnet lift non-ferrous materials like aluminum or copper?
No, this electromagnet is designed exclusively for ferrous materials such as iron and steel. Non-ferrous metals like aluminum, copper, brass, and stainless steel are not magnetic and cannot be lifted by this electromagnet. The magnetic field only attracts ferrous materials with iron content. For non-ferrous material handling, you would need alternative lifting methods such as mechanical grippers or hydraulic systems.
